Dragon Drive: D-Masters Shot is a third-person shooter video game released in 2003 by Treasure Co. Ltd. The game is based on the Dragon Drive series and was only released in Japan.
There are no listings for this product at the moment.
Do you own a copy of Dragon Drive: D-Masters Shot? List your own on Retro Market!